AI/Trend

AI API 예산 초과 방지: Costile 오픈소스 프록시 소개

Royzero 2026. 4. 14. 22:46
반응형

TL;DR

AI API 호출에서 발생하는 예산 초과 문제는 실무자들에게 큰 골칫거리입니다. Costile은 OpenAI 및 Anthropic API와 같은 AI 서비스를 사용할 때, 예산 한도를 초과하지 않도록 요청을 실시간으로 차단하는 오픈소스 프록시입니다. 간단한 환경 변수 설정만으로 적용할 수 있으며, AI 운영 환경에서 예산 관리와 비용 절감에 큰 도움을 줄 수 있습니다.


API 예산 초과 문제와 Costile의 필요성

AI API를 활용한 서비스는 점점 더 복잡해지고 있으며, API 호출 비용이 예산을 초과하는 상황이 빈번히 발생하고 있습니다. 특히 OpenAI나 Anthropic과 같은 AI API는 호출량이 많아지면 예상치 못한 높은 비용을 초래할 수 있습니다. 일반적으로 제공되는 예산 초과 알림은 사후적으로 도착하며, 실시간으로 예산을 관리하기 어렵습니다.

Costile은 이러한 문제를 해결하기 위해 개발된 오픈소스 프록시입니다. Costile은 API 호출을 모니터링하며, 사용자 설정에 따라 예산 한도를 초과하는 요청을 즉시 차단합니다. 이를 통해 불필요한 API 호출 비용을 사전에 방지할 수 있습니다.


Costile의 주요 기능 및 동작 방식

Costile은 간단한 설정으로 AI API 호출 관리를 쉽게 만들어줍니다. 주요 기능은 다음과 같습니다:

  1. 실시간 예산 관리:
    - Costile은 사용자가 설정한 일일 또는 월간 예산 한도를 기준으로 API 요청을 모니터링합니다.
    - 한도를 초과하는 요청이 발생하면 즉시 차단하여 추가 비용 발생을 방지합니다.

  2. 환경 변수 기반 설정:
    - 기존의 API 호출 설정에서 단순히 환경 변수를 변경하는 것만으로 Costile을 적용할 수 있습니다.
    - 예: API_URL=https://api.openai.comAPI_URL=https://costile.com

  3. 사용량 대시보드:
    - Costile은 사용량 데이터를 실시간으로 제공하여, API 호출 패턴을 시각화하고 이해할 수 있도록 도와줍니다.

  4. 오픈소스 기반:
    - Costile은 오픈소스 소프트웨어로, 누구나 무료로 사용 및 커스터마이징할 수 있습니다.
    - GitHub 리포지토리: Tonone-AI/elephant


Costile의 동작 원리

Costile은 중간에 위치한 프록시 서버로, 클라이언트와 AI API 사이에 위치합니다. 다음은 Costile의 기본 동작 흐름입니다:

  1. 클라이언트가 API 요청을 보냄.
  2. 요청이 Costile 프록시 서버를 통과.
  3. Costile은 현재 예산 사용량을 확인.
  4. 예산 한도를 초과하는 요청은 즉시 차단하고 클라이언트에 알림.
  5. 예산 한도 내 요청은 정상적으로 AI API에 전달.

이러한 방식으로 Costile은 실시간으로 API 호출을 제어하며, 실무자들에게 투명하고 신뢰할 수 있는 비용 관리 도구를 제공합니다.


Costile의 장점과 단점

장점 단점
오픈소스 및 무료 사용 가능 초기 설정이 다소 복잡할 수 있음
실시간 예산 관리 가능 특정 API와의 완벽한 호환성 필요
간단한 환경 변수로 설정 가능 프록시 서버 성능에 따라 지연 발생 가능
커스터마이징 및 확장성 제공 사용량 분석 기능은 제한적일 수 있음

실무 적용 사례 및 운영 팁

사례: 소규모 스타트업의 AI 운영

한 소규모 스타트업은 OpenAI API를 사용해 고객 지원 챗봇을 운영하던 중, 잘못된 설정으로 인해 수백 달러의 추가 비용이 발생했습니다. Costile을 도입한 이후, API 사용량을 실시간으로 추적하고 예산 한도 초과를 방지할 수 있었습니다.

운영 팁:
- 정확한 한도 설정: 예산 한도를 설정할 때, 예상 사용량과 비상 상황을 고려하세요.
- 로그 모니터링: Costile의 로그를 정기적으로 검토하여 비정상적인 요청을 파악하세요.
- 테스트 환경 분리: 테스트와 운영 환경을 분리해 예산 초과를 방지하세요.


자주 묻는 질문 (FAQ)

Q1. Costile은 어떤 API와 호환되나요?

Costile은 OpenAI, Anthropic API를 포함한 대부분의 HTTP 기반 AI API와 호환됩니다.

Q2. Costile은 무료인가요?

네, Costile은 오픈소스 소프트웨어로 무료로 제공됩니다. GitHub에서 소스 코드를 다운로드받아 사용할 수 있습니다.

Q3. 예산 한도를 어떻게 설정하나요?

환경 변수 파일을 통해 일일 또는 월간 예산 한도를 설정할 수 있습니다.

Q4. Costile 사용 시 API 호출 속도가 느려지나요?

프록시 서버의 성능에 따라 다를 수 있지만, 일반적으로 미미한 지연만 발생합니다.

Q5. Costile을 사용할 때 추가 비용이 드나요?

Costile 자체는 무료지만, 프록시 서버를 운영하는 데 드는 비용은 사용자가 부담해야 합니다.

Q6. 예산 초과 시 알림을 받을 수 있나요?

네, Costile은 예산 초과 시 이메일 알림을 보낼 수 있는 기능을 제공합니다.

Q7. 기존 API 설정을 변경해야 하나요?

네, 환경 변수에서 API 엔드포인트를 Costile 프록시로 변경해야 합니다.


결론

Costile은 AI API 호출 비용을 효과적으로 관리할 수 있는 강력한 도구입니다. 실시간 예산 관리를 통해 예산 초과를 방지하고, 운영 비용 절감에 기여할 수 있습니다. 특히, 오픈소스 기반으로 제공되므로 스타트업 및 중소기업에도 적합한 솔루션입니다.

References

  • (Tonone-AI/elephant GitHub Repository, 2026-04-14)[https://github.com/tonone-ai/elephant]
  • (Hacker News Discussion on Costile, 2026-04-14)[https://news.ycombinator.com/item?id=47765319]
  • (Costile Official Website, 2026-04-14)[https://costile.com/]
  • (OpenAI Pricing Documentation, 2026-04-14)[https://openai.com/pricing]
  • (Anthropic API Documentation, 2026-04-14)[https://www.anthropic.com/docs]
  • (The Verge - Samsung Price Hike, 2026-04-14)[https://www.theverge.com/tech/911623/samsung-galaxy-phones-tablets-price-hike-ram]
  • (Science Advances - Biased AI Writing Assistants, 2026-04-14)[https://www.science.org/doi/10.1126/sciadv.adw5578]
  • (Nobulex AI Agent Proof System, 2026-04-14)[https://nobulex.com/playground]
반응형